. SKJuS was formed following a split from the League of Communists of Yugoslavia (SKJ). The founder of SKJuS was the general secretary of SKJ, Stevan Mirkovic.

SKJuS publishes Stvarnost.

SKJuS took part in the 2000 parliamentary elections. It got 0.049% of the votes.
